Abstract
Let G be a connected graph containing a perfect matching.G is said to be bipartite matching extendable if every matching M of G whose induced subgraph is a bipartite matching extends to a perfect matching of G. To further study the bipartite matching extendable graphs,we consider the bipartite matching number of G,denoted by BM (G) ,is the number of edges of a maximum bipartite matching of G. In this paper we prove that Cn×P2 is 2-Bipartite matching extendable.
